Ornith-

Meaning: bird

Root word: Greek ὄρνις, ὄρνιθος (órnis, órnithos)

Roots with similar meanings:

  • avi- meaning “bird”
  • pter- meaning “wing”
  • psittac- meaning “parrot”
  • passer- meaning “sparrow”

Roots with opposite meanings:

Roots that could be confused:

  • orn- meaning “decorate”

Derived English Words

Commonly encountered words are in bold.

euornithic: Relating to true or modern birds.

neornithic: Relating to modern birds, typically those classified within the subclass Neornithes.

ornithic: Of or relating to birds.

ornithine: An amino acid that is part of the urea cycle and plays a role in the metabolism of nitrogen.

ornithivorous: Feeding on birds.

ornithocoprolite: Fossilized bird droppings.

ornitholite: A fossilized bird or the fossil remains of birds.

ornithography: The study or description of birds.

ornithologist: A scientist who studies birds.

ornithology: The branch of zoology that deals with the study of birds.

ornithomancy: Divination or predicting the future by observing the flight and behavior of birds.

ornithocephalic: Having a head that resembles that of a bird.

ornithoid: Bird-like in appearance or characteristics.

ornithomorph: Resembling or having the form of a bird.

ornithon: An aviary or a place where birds are kept.

ornithomania: An intense enthusiasm or obsession with birds.

ornithophile: A person who loves or is fond of birds.

philornithic: Having a fondness for birds; bird-loving.

ornithoscopy: the observation of birds for scientific or divination purposes.

ornithophobia: An irrational fear of birds.

ornithopter: A flying machine designed to mimic the flight of birds by flapping wings.

ornithomyzous: Referring to bird parasites, especially bird-infesting insects.

ornithosis: A disease affecting birds, caused by Chlamydia psittaci, and transmissible to humans (psittacosis).

panornithic: Relating to or encompassing all birds.

Other Uses

ichthyornithic: Pertaining to Ichthyornis, an extinct genus of toothed seabirds.

odontornithic: Referring to extinct birds that possessed teeth, such as Hesperornis or Ichthyornis.

ornithischian: Referring to a group of herbivorous dinosaurs characterized by a pelvic structure similar to that of birds.

ornithodelph: Referring to monotremes, a group of egg-laying mammals, such as the platypus.

ornithomimid: Referring to Ornithomimidae, a family of bird-mimicking, fast-running theropod dinosaurs.

ornithopod: A type of bipedal herbivorous dinosaur, part of the clade Ornithopoda.

ornithorhynchus: The genus name for the platypus, an egg-laying mammal native to Australia.

ornithosaurian: Relating to Pterosauria, flying reptiles that coexisted with dinosaurs.

stereornithic: Relating to large, prehistoric, flightless birds known as Stereornithes.

ornithuric acid: Chemical found in the excrement of birds.
